Durability Testing Results

To assess the Ze3000’s durability, a series of rigorous tests were conducted, simulating real-world conditions. The results demonstrate that the earphones are built to last, withstanding impacts, bending, and environmental factors.

Drop Test

The Ze3000 was subjected to multiple drops from heights of 1.5 meters onto various surfaces. The housings showed no signs of cracks or deformation, and the internal components remained intact, confirming excellent impact resistance.

Flexibility and Cable Stress Test

The braided cables were bent repeatedly at different angles to test their flexibility. Even after thousands of bends, the cables maintained their integrity without fraying or loss of signal quality.
